It is beneficial for cats to eat chicken breast as a source of supplementary protein, but it should not be their only food source. It is recommended to feed chicken breast 2 to 3 times a week, with an appropriate amount each time to ensure balanced nutrition. Chicken breasts should be cooked and boneless to avoid bacteria and parasites in raw meat. At the same time, make sure your cat's diet contains enough fat, vitamins and minerals. |
